T_Cyjb_Markdown_Syntax_CodeBlock - CYJB/Cyjb.Markdown GitHub Wiki
表示 Markdown 的代码块。
System.Object
Cyjb.Markdown.Syntax.Node
Cyjb.Markdown.Syntax.BlockNode
Cyjb.Markdown.Syntax.CodeBlock
Namespace: Cyjb.Markdown.Syntax
Assembly: Cyjb.Markdown (in Cyjb.Markdown.dll) Version: 1.0.2+f073417ab111e884603147b5dc42e8ccc863a984
C#
public sealed class CodeBlock : BlockNode,
IEquatable<CodeBlock>The CodeBlock type exposes the following members.
| 名称 | 说明 | |
|---|---|---|
![]() |
CodeBlock | 使用指定的代码内容和文本范围初始化 CodeBlock 类的新实例。 |
| 名称 | 说明 | |
|---|---|---|
![]() |
Attributes | 获取代码块的属性列表。 |
![]() |
Content | 获取或设置代码块的内容。 |
![]() |
FirstChild |
获取第一个子节点,如果不存在则返回 null。
(继承自 Node。) |
![]() |
Info | 获取或设置代码的信息。 |
![]() |
IsHtml | 获取节点是否是 HTML 节点。 (继承自 Node。) |
![]() |
Kind | 获取节点的类型。 (继承自 Node。) |
![]() |
LastChild |
获取最后一个子节点,如果不存在则返回 null。
(继承自 Node。) |
![]() |
LinePositionSpan | 获取节点的行列位置范围。 (继承自 Node。) |
![]() |
Locator | 获取或设置关联到的行定位器。 (继承自 Node。) |
![]() |
Next | 获取后继兄弟节点。 (继承自 BlockNode。) |
![]() |
Parent | 获取所属父节点。 (继承自 Node。) |
![]() |
Prev | 获取前驱兄弟节点。 (继承自 BlockNode。) |
![]() |
Span | 获取或设置节点的文本范围。 (继承自 Node。) |
| 名称 | 说明 | |
|---|---|---|
![]() |
Accept(SyntaxVisitor) | 应用指定的访问器。 (重写 Node.Accept(SyntaxVisitor).) |
![]() |
Accept(TResult)(SyntaxVisitor(TResult)) | 应用指定的访问器。 (重写 Node.Accept(TResult)(SyntaxVisitor(TResult)).) |
![]() |
Accept(TResult)(SyntaxVisitor(TResult)) | 应用指定的访问器。 (继承自 Node。) |
![]() |
Equals(CodeBlock) | 返回当前对象是否等于同一类型的另一对象。 |
![]() |
Equals(Object) | 返回当前对象是否等于另一对象。 (重写 Object.Equals(Object).) |
![]() |
GetHashCode | 返回当前对象的哈希值。 (重写 Object.GetHashCode().) |
![]() |
GetType | Gets the Type of the current instance. (继承自 Object。) |
![]() |
Remove | 将当前节点从父节点中移除。 (继承自 Node。) |
![]() |
ToString | 返回当前对象的字符串表示形式。 (重写 Node.ToString().) |
| 名称 | 说明 | |
|---|---|---|
![]()
|
Equality | 返回指定的 CodeBlock 是否相等。 |
![]()
|
Inequality | 返回指定的 CodeBlock 是否不相等。 |


